13 year old sailing inspiration, Flo Tovey, conquers sailing the Bristol Channel solo

by Joann Randles 22 Sep 2021 15:11 BST 18 September 2021

A 13-year-old sailed single-handedly across the Bristol Channel on Saturday 18 September 2021.

Flo Tovey embarked on the challenge she had been planning over the last nine months: to sail solo across the Bristol channel crossing in her single-handed Topper dinghy.

Flo explained: "(It) is approximately 24 miles in my Topper dinghy a trip, which to everyone's knowledge has not been done before."

Flo, who is a member of the Welsh Topper sailing squad, set off from Mumbles, Swansea at 9am and arrived at Ilfracombe around 4pm. The journey raised over £4,000 for Maiden Factor Foundation, a global ambassador for the empowerment of girls through education The first time Flo's parents knew about the incredible challenge she had set herself was when Flo received an email from British sailor, Tracy Edwards MBE, after Flo had independently emailed the charity, The Maiden Factor, explaining to them that she would raise money and awareness for the charity by sailing the Bristol Channel.

In a video by The Maiden Factor charity, Tracy Edwards MBE explains, this is a "ground breaking feat: Sailing a Topper from Mumbles to Ilfracombe across the Bristol channel. We don't think it's ever been done before, and this will be an absolutely fantastic record."
